Price and rent in ZIP 78759
ZIP 78759 is around the 71st percentile of tracked local ZIPs for home value. ZIP 78759 is around the 21st percentile of tracked local ZIPs for rent.
ZIP 78759 home value & rent trend (past 12 months)
Typical home value fell 1.6% over the last 11 months, from $671,436 to $660,733. It rose in 2 of 10 monthly readings. The largest monthly gain was +0.3% in July 2026.
Typical rent fell 0.2% over the last 11 months, from $1,463 to $1,459. It rose in 6 of 10 monthly readings. The largest monthly gain was +1.0% in July 2026.
How ZIP 78759 compares to Austin
ZIP 78759's typical home value is 18.0% above the Austin median of $559,762. ZIP 78759's typical rent is 14.1% below the Austin median of $1,698. ZIP 78759's buyer competition is 2.2% below the Austin median of 45.
How fast homes sell in ZIP 78759
Homes in ZIP 78759 typically go pending in about 58 days — about 2% faster than the metro median of 59 days.
